chugging - definition and synonyms

  1.   From our crowdsourced Open Dictionary
    the practice of stopping people on the street and trying to persuade them to give money regularly to a charity

    One of the world's leading charities is to abandon 'chugging' because the public finds it so irritating.

    Submitted from United Kingdom on 06/03/2012